Inventory Reconciliation Process: A Step-by-Step Workflow

The inventory reconciliation process is a repeatable workflow that ties physical stock counts to system records, investigates variances, and posts audit-ready adjustments to keep your GL and subledger in sync. Here is the shortest workable version:
- Freeze a snapshot. Lock a timestamp across every source (ERP, WMS, marketplace, POS) before counting begins.
- Match sources. Compare physical counts to system records by SKU, location, and unit of measure. Flag anything outside tolerance.
- Resolve exceptions and post adjustments. Investigate flagged items, assign reason codes, get approvals, and post correcting journal entries.

What the inventory reconciliation process actually covers
Inventory reconciliation is a structured process of matching recorded balances across systems with physical stock, investigating variances, and posting corrective adjustments to ensure GL and subledger accuracy. That definition is clean, but it papers over a real tension between what operations cares about and what finance needs.

Operations teams focus on item-level accuracy: is the right SKU in the right bin, in the right quantity, ready to pick? Finance teams focus on the GL tie-out: does the inventory asset account match the subledger, are COGS entries correct, and is there documented evidence for the auditors? Both are right, and a reconciliation that satisfies only one of them will create problems for the other.
The snapshot concept is where these two perspectives converge. Before any count begins, you freeze a point-in-time record of what every system says you have. In a perpetual inventory system, that snapshot is pulled from live records and compared to a physical count. In a periodic system, the snapshot is the last recorded balance, and the count replaces it entirely. Perpetual systems give you more frequent reconciliation opportunities and smaller variance pools to investigate; periodic systems require more work at each close but are common in smaller operations.
Audit-readiness is not a year-end project. The AICPA’s guidance on inventory as a material balance sheet item expects documented count procedures, approved adjustments, and evidence of investigation for significant variances , not just a number that ties out.
For U.S. companies where inventory is a material balance, annual physical verification is a baseline expectation. But the teams that close fastest and with the fewest audit findings run reconciliations continuously, not just at year-end.
Step-by-step inventory reconciliation workflow you can repeat every cycle
The steps below follow the proven approach used across operations and finance teams. Run them in order; skipping the freeze step is the single most common cause of reconciliation failures.
- Gather and align sources , Pull records from your ERP, WMS, marketplace settlement reports (Amazon, Shopify, eBay), POS, and any spreadsheets still in use. Confirm that each source uses the same SKU identifiers and units of measure before you try to match them.
Matching rules and tolerance table
| Match type | Rule | Date tolerance | Value tolerance |
|---|---|---|---|
| One-to-one (PO to receipt) | Exact SKU, quantity, UoM | ±1 business day | , |
| Many-to-one (invoice to receipts) | Sum of receipts = invoice total | ±3 business days | ±2% or $50 |
| Marketplace settlement to orders | Net payout = sum of order lines minus fees | Settlement period | , |
| Physical count to system record | Count quantity = system quantity | Same snapshot | ±1 unit or 1% |
Reason codes and approval thresholds
| Reason code | Description | Approval tier |
|---|---|---|
| MIS-PICK | Item picked incorrectly, wrong SKU shipped | Supervisor |
| DAMAGED | Item damaged in warehouse or transit | Supervisor |
| SUPPLIER-SHORT | Vendor shipped fewer units than invoiced | Purchasing manager |
| UNRECORDED-RECEIPT | Receipt not logged in WMS/ERP | Warehouse manager |
| DATA-ENTRY | Quantity or SKU entered incorrectly | Supervisor |
| SHRINKAGE | Unexplained loss (theft, spoilage) | Finance director |
Approval thresholds depend on your organization’s policy and materiality standards. Typically, smaller variances can be approved by a supervisor, moderate variances require manager approval, and significant variances need finance director approval before posting.
Pro Tip: Configure your WMS or reconciliation software to auto-post adjustments that fall below your low-risk threshold (e.g., single-unit data-entry corrections with a DATA-ENTRY code). Reserve human review for exceptions above $500 or flagged as SHRINKAGE. This alone can cut manual reconciliation time by a third in high-volume operations.
Exception investigation checklist
When an exception clears your tolerance filter, work through these steps before posting:
- Recount the physical location independently (blind recount, different counter).
- Sweep adjacent bins for misplaced stock.
- Trace the transaction history: pull the PO, ASN, and invoice for the SKU and verify each step.
- Contact the vendor if a supplier-short code is likely.
- Document every step taken, including negative findings (e.g., “bin 4B swept, no stock found”).
Which counting method fits your reconciliation schedule?
Perpetual reconciliation runs continuously: every transaction updates the system record, and variances surface in real time. Periodic reconciliation resets the record at a fixed interval (monthly, quarterly, annually) based on a physical count. Most modern operations run perpetual systems with cycle counts layered on top, using full physical counts only as an annual verification or after a significant event like a warehouse move.
Counting methods compared
| Method | Best for | Operational impact | Audit value |
|---|---|---|---|
| Cycle count (ABC) | Ongoing accuracy, high-velocity SKUs | Low (counts spread across year) | High (continuous evidence) |
| Full physical count | Annual verification, periodic systems | High (operations pause) | High (point-in-time snapshot) |
| Opportunistic count | Returns spikes, negative stock events | Minimal (triggered by event) | Medium |
| RFID/sample-based | Large SKU catalogs, high-value items | Low to medium | Medium to high |
ABC cadence matrix
- A items (top 20% of SKUs by value or velocity): count monthly, or more frequently if negative stock incidents occur.
- B items (middle 30%): count quarterly.
- C items (bottom 50%): count semi-annually or annually.
Trigger an opportunistic count outside the normal cadence when you see: a negative stock flag, a spike in returns for a specific SKU, or a newly received high-value shipment that has not yet been confirmed in the WMS.
What actually causes inventory discrepancies
Inventory discrepancies surface during physical counts and daily operations alike. A warehouse worker finds the bin empty when the system shows 40 units; an accountant spots a GL balance that does not match the subledger. The causes fall into predictable categories, and knowing the category tells you where to look first.
Common root causes:
- Manual data entry errors (wrong quantity, wrong SKU, transposed digits)
- Unrecorded receipts or shipments (goods received but not logged, or shipped without a pick confirmation)
- SKU or location mismatches (same item under two part numbers, or stock in an unmapped bin)
- Return processing delays (customer return received but not yet restocked or credited in the system)
- Shrinkage (damage, theft, or spoilage not recorded as a write-off)
- Timing differences at cut-off (a receipt posted after the snapshot freeze)
- Unit-of-measure mismatches (cases vs. eaches, pounds vs. kilograms)
- Consignment and intercompany gaps (stock you hold but do not own, or stock transferred between entities without a matching transaction)
Investigation priority matrix
Prioritize exceptions in this order before routing to investigators:
- High dollar value + A-item SKU. Investigate immediately; do not post an adjustment without a full trace.
- High unit variance + B-item SKU. Recount and trace within 24 hours.
- SHRINKAGE code, any value. Escalate to finance director regardless of dollar amount.
- Timing difference, low value. Confirm the transaction posted correctly and close without a count adjustment.
- Data-entry error, low value. Correct and auto-post if below the auto-post threshold.
Triage rules: Recount when the variance is more than 5 units or 5% of system quantity. Trace transactions when the recount confirms the variance. Post an immediate adjustment only when the cause is confirmed and documented. Escalate to finance or procurement when the cause cannot be confirmed within two business days.
Tools and integrations that cut manual reconciliation work
The integration chain that matters is: WMS → ERP → accounting system (QuickBooks or Xero) → marketplaces (Amazon, Shopify, eBay). Every link in that chain needs to use the same canonical identifiers and aligned timestamps, or you will spend more time normalizing data than investigating real exceptions.

Amazon adds a specific layer of complexity: multi-region settlements, reserve holds, fee lumping, and FBA-specific reimbursement windows that close if you miss them. Parsing Amazon settlement reports means mapping fee lines to individual orders and reconciling payouts against inventory adjustments simultaneously. Manual processes cannot keep up with that volume reliably.
Must-have automation features for any reconciliation tool:
- Configurable matching rules and tolerances (so you define what “match” means for your business)
- Many-to-one matching (one invoice matched to multiple receipts, or one settlement to multiple orders)
- Automated reason-code assignment for common patterns
- Scheduled reconciliation runs (daily, weekly, or at settlement period close)
- Automated adjustment creation for low-risk exceptions below your threshold
- Full audit-trail capture (who matched what, when, and why)
Scheduled auto-reconciliation with automatic stock adjustment creation, as seen in Amazon FBA integration patterns, reduces manual work and maintains a continuous audit trail without requiring a human to trigger each run.
For Amazon sellers specifically, tracking FBA inventory accurately requires continuous monitoring of inbound shipments and ledger events, not just periodic settlement downloads. The reimbursement window for lost or damaged FBA inventory is finite; automation that surfaces exceptions in real time recovers money that manual monthly reviews miss.
Accurate inventory is also foundational to reliable reorder alerts, COGS management, and landed cost calculations. Reconciliation failures cascade into poor planning and inflated working capital, not just accounting errors.
How to post adjustments and keep your GL audit-ready
Posting an adjustment without documentation is the fastest way to create an audit finding. Every journal entry that touches the inventory asset account needs a paper trail: what changed, why, who approved it, and what evidence supports the decision.
Approval tiers for posting
- Under $500 or 2% of SKU value (whichever is lower): Supervisor approval, reason code required, auto-post eligible.
- $500 to $2,000: Warehouse or operations manager approval, investigation notes required.
- Above $2,000: Finance director approval, full investigation documentation required before posting.
- SHRINKAGE code, any amount: Finance director approval regardless of dollar value; consider whether a write-off or insurance claim is appropriate.
GL tie-out checklist
- Verify the inventory clearing account balance is zero after all receipts and shipments post.
- Confirm the inventory asset account on the GL matches the subledger total to the penny.
- Review COGS entries for the period: adjustments that write down inventory increase COGS; write-ups decrease it. Reconciliation adjustments that affect COGS calculations flow directly to gross margin.
- Post journal entries for any remaining GL/subledger difference with full documentation.
- Run a final subledger-to-GL comparison after posting to confirm the tie-out holds.
Evidence retention
For U.S. operations, retain the following for each reconciliation cycle:
- Count sheets or scanner logs (with counter ID and timestamp)
- Invoices, POs, and ASNs supporting each adjustment
- Photos of damaged goods for SHRINKAGE adjustments
- Investigation notes, including negative findings
- Approval records (approver name, role, date, and dollar amount approved)
The IRS generally expects business records to be kept for at least three years, and auditors sampling inventory balances will ask for count evidence and adjustment approvals. Storing these in a centralized, searchable system is far more practical than hunting through email threads at year-end.
Audit evidence is not just about having the documents. It is about being able to produce them quickly, in a format that shows a clear chain of custody from count to adjustment to posted journal entry.
KPIs and best practices that show reconciliation is working
Reconciliation health is measurable. If you are not tracking these metrics, you are managing by feel.
Reconciliation KPI targets
| KPI | Description | Illustrative target |
|---|---|---|
| Variance value as % of inventory | Total adjustment value / total inventory value | <1% per cycle |
| Recount rate | % of counts requiring a second count | <5% |
| Exception aging | % of exceptions resolved within 48 hours | >90% |
| Cycle count coverage | % of A items counted in the period | monthly or more frequent |
| Negative stock incidents | Count of SKUs with negative system quantity | minimal target |
| Month-end adjustment stability | Variance in total adjustment value cycle-over-cycle | Declining trend |
Continuous improvement checklist:
- Review reason-code distribution monthly. If DATA-ENTRY codes dominate, the fix is training or barcode scanning, not more reconciliations.
- Track exception aging. Exceptions that sit open for more than 72 hours usually indicate a process gap, not a data problem.
- Run root-cause trending quarterly. A centralized adjustments log with consistent reason codes and approver IDs lets you distinguish between tactical fixes and systemic issues.
- Feed reconciliation findings back into procurement and forecasting. A supplier that consistently ships short should show up in your vendor scorecard, not just your reason-code log.

Handling consignment, damaged goods, and in-transit inventory
These three inventory types cause more reconciliation headaches than their volume justifies, because standard matching logic does not handle them well without configuration.
Consignment inventory sits in your warehouse but belongs to a vendor until you sell it. It should not appear on your balance sheet as an owned asset. The reconciliation risk is that WMS systems often track consignment stock alongside owned stock, and a count that lumps them together will overstate your inventory asset. Maintain a separate consignment register, reconcile it against vendor statements monthly, and confirm your WMS tags consignment items with a distinct ownership flag.
Damaged goods need a write-down at the time damage is confirmed, not at year-end. When a damaged item is identified during a count, assign a SHRINKAGE or DAMAGED reason code immediately, photograph the item, and route the adjustment for finance director approval before the item is disposed of or returned to the vendor. Waiting to batch these at month-end creates a spike in adjustments that looks worse to auditors than a steady trickle of small, well-documented write-downs.
In-transit inventory is stock that has left the vendor but has not yet been received into your WMS. It is an asset you own (assuming FOB shipping point terms) but cannot physically count. Reconcile in-transit items against open POs and ASNs at each close. If a shipment is more than five business days past its expected arrival, flag it for investigation: it may be lost, held at customs, or simply unconfirmed in the system.
For FBA sellers, in-transit inventory between your prep center and Amazon’s fulfillment network is a particularly common source of discrepancies. How inventory reconciliation affects financial reporting and compliance
Inventory is often the largest asset on a product company’s balance sheet. How you reconcile it directly affects your income statement, your tax position, and your audit exposure.
Under U.S. GAAP, inventory must be reported at the lower of cost or net realizable value. That means write-downs from reconciliation adjustments (damaged goods, obsolescence, shrinkage) are not optional accounting entries; they are required when the evidence exists. Delaying a write-down to protect a quarterly gross margin number is a GAAP violation, not a judgment call.
COGS accuracy depends entirely on reconciled inventory. If your ending inventory balance is overstated because shrinkage was not recorded, your COGS is understated and your gross profit is inflated. That error flows through to income tax calculations, which is why the IRS takes inventory accuracy seriously in audits of product businesses.
For public companies and those preparing for acquisition, auditors will sample inventory transactions and ask for count evidence, adjustment approvals, and GL tie-out documentation. A reconciliation process that produces clean, searchable evidence for every adjustment is the difference between a clean audit opinion and a material weakness finding.
E-commerce sellers face an additional layer: marketplace settlement reconciliation must tie out to both the inventory subledger and the revenue accounts. Multi-region settlements, reserve holds, and fee complexity mean that a single Amazon settlement period can contain dozens of line items that need to be mapped before the GL entry is correct.
Sales tax compliance is also affected. In states with economic nexus thresholds, accurate inventory and sales records are the foundation of a defensible sales tax position. Reconciliation gaps that distort revenue or inventory balances can create exposure in a state tax audit.

The mistake most teams make with reconciliation
Most reconciliation problems are not counting problems; they are identifier problems and freeze problems.
Teams spend hours investigating variances that exist only because the WMS uses UPCs and the ERP uses internal part numbers, with no maintained crosswalk. Or they start counting before locking the snapshot, so receipts post during the count and create phantom variances that take twice as long to clear as real ones. These are process failures, not data failures, and no amount of better counting fixes them.
The other persistent mistake is treating reason codes as a compliance checkbox rather than a diagnostic tool. When every unexplained variance gets coded as SHRINKAGE, you lose the signal. A month of DATA-ENTRY codes concentrated on one receiving dock tells you exactly where to put a barcode scanner. A month of SUPPLIER-SHORT codes on one vendor tells you to renegotiate your receiving terms. That signal disappears the moment codes become arbitrary.
Three fixes that work immediately: standardize your SKU identifiers and units of measure across every system before the next reconciliation cycle (a one-time crosswalk table is enough to start). Tighten your freeze protocol so no transactions post during the count window, even if that means a two-hour system lock. And configure auto-posting for low-risk adjustments below your threshold so your team spends time on the exceptions that actually matter, not on approving single-unit data-entry corrections one by one.
Teams that implement all three typically see their exception aging drop and their month-end close shorten within two or three cycles. The KPI improvement is real, but the bigger gain is that reconciliation stops feeling like a fire drill and starts functioning as a control.
